Cybersecurity Best Practices for Businesses and Individuals

In today's interconnected world, safeguarding your digital assets has become paramount. Both businesses and individuals must implement robust cybersecurity practices to minimize the risk of cyberattacks. Firstly, it is crucial to use strong passwords that incorporate a combination of uppercase and lowercase letters, numbers, and symbols. Avoid repeating passwords across multiple accounts and enable multi-factor authentication whenever possible.

Regularly patch software applications and operating systems to correct known vulnerabilities. Be cautious when opening email attachments or clicking on links from unknown sources. Educate members about phishing scams and social engineering tactics. Implement firewalls and antivirus software to protect your devices from malicious threats. Regularly save important data to an remote location to ensure its recovery in case of a breach. Lastly, stay informed about the latest cybersecurity trends and best practices by participating industry webinars and publications.
